Living on a hobby farm-the idea seems idyllic, doesn't it? Yeah, you betcha'...not when you have to slog out to feed the livestock in twenty-below-zero weather, with a raging blizzard and 30 mile-an-hour winds. When you live in the frozen tundra otherwise known as Minnesota, that kind of thing tends to happen.

Or consider the delights of a Minnesota summer-when the temperature hovers above 90 degrees and the humidity is 10,000 percent. The animals still need to be tended, and the copious quantities of manure disposed of. Yup. It's all fun and games. At least until the manure piles up.

If you've ever dreamed of having your own hobby farm, living off the land, and communing with nature-this book will open your eyes to what it's really like. You'll laugh, you will probably cry a little, and you'll scratch your head and wonder, "What in the heck was she thinking?!"
